Interesting, I cannot relate to your lack of self-questioning your beliefs in this matter but I am positive I am similar about topics I feel strongly about in other areas.
While I feel it is delicious, I think there a multitude of things which are enjoyable, yet morally wrong.
Thank you for this exchange, I understand your position better and i hope I have helped to elucidate mine.